编程及软件开发解决方案库

2000万优秀解决方案库,覆盖所有编程及软件开发类,极速查询

今日已更新 1628 篇代码解决方案

  • 1:bzoj 3196 树套树模板

    比较裸的<em>线段</em>树套平衡树,比较不好想的是求区间第k大时需要二分一下答案,然

    https://www.u72.net/daima/w4ac.html - 2024-08-26 00:18:20 - 代码库
  • 2:HDU 3062 简单的2-SAT问题

    在2-SAT,最让我纠结的还是添加有向<em>线段</em>的函数了void add_clause(int i,int a,int j,int b){    int m=2

    https://www.u72.net/daima/wrse.html - 2024-07-16 01:41:57 - 代码库
  • 3:sgu 128

    原来<em>线段</em>树还可以这么用。贴代码。

    https://www.u72.net/daima/rf0b.html - 2024-07-11 21:41:38 - 代码库
  • 4:POJ 3264

    这道题作为<em>线段</em>树的入门题吧,不涉及更新。   代码挺长的,所以在敲的时候挺多地方出了问题。

    https://www.u72.net/daima/s1s7.html - 2024-07-13 07:21:15 - 代码库
  • 5:LightOJ 1062 - Crossed Ladders 基础计算几何

    problem=1062  题意:问两条平行边间的距离,给出从同一水平面出发的两条相交<em>线段</em>长,及它们交点到水平面的

    https://www.u72.net/daima/we7a.html - 2024-08-26 10:39:22 - 代码库
  • 6:树状数组求区间最大值(树状数组)(复习)

    当遇到单点更新时,树状数组往往比<em>线段</em>树更实用。算法:设原数序列为a[i],最大值为h[i](树状数组)。1。单点更新:直接更新a[i],然后再更新h[i]。若h[i]

    https://www.u72.net/daima/ua2k.html - 2024-08-21 10:45:37 - 代码库
  • 7:11月下旬题解

    (压根就没做几道题,无地自容QAQ)gym101138 J直接上树链剖分+<em>线段</em>树,注意处理好端点问题(其实有(Q+N)logN的做法)  1 #include

    https://www.u72.net/daima/v802.html - 2024-08-24 14:32:08 - 代码库
  • 8:poj2451Uyuw's Concert(半平面交)

    链接逆时针给出<em>线段</em>,如果模板是顺时针的修改下系数的符号进行平面交即可。

    https://www.u72.net/daima/v90z.html - 2024-07-15 15:13:06 - 代码库
  • 9:hdu1166

    没有用到懒惰标记的<em>线段</em>树问题,不过通过这道题找到了不用数组就能找到写update的方法了#include&lt;iostream&gt;#include&lt;queue

    https://www.u72.net/daima/v08d.html - 2024-07-15 07:39:00 - 代码库
  • 10:覆盖统计

    覆盖统计(axis.c/cpp/pas)【题目大意】数轴上有一些点,从 1 标记到n,逐渐被<em>线段</em>覆盖, 求每次覆盖后未被覆盖的点的个数。

    https://www.u72.net/daima/sc03.html - 2024-07-13 00:07:11 - 代码库
  • 11:HDU 3265 Posters

    题意:求矩形面积的并  每个矩形里面有个小的矩形被挖空思路:经典的<em>线段</em>树扫描线  我竟然坑了3个小时没写出来…真是鄙视自己!!学过扫描线的都会有思路  这

    https://www.u72.net/daima/sffk.html - 2024-07-12 23:00:56 - 代码库
  • 12:hdu 1556 Color the ball

    基础  树状数组每输入一组数,就对染色次数进行修改;树状数组中的每个节点都代表了一段<em>线段</em>区间,每次更新的时候,根据树状数组的特性可以把b以前包含的所有

    https://www.u72.net/daima/scd3.html - 2024-07-12 23:47:41 - 代码库
  • 13:ACM1258邻接表

    教训:使用邻接表的时候一定要把邻接表的结构组定义的足够大,不能仅仅等于节点的个数,因为<em>线段</em>的数量往往远超过节点的数量。这个题目是拓扑排序练习,提高下

    https://www.u72.net/daima/vn4n.html - 2024-07-14 18:40:36 - 代码库
  • 14:hdu-1166敌兵布阵

    这个题目就是考察<em>线段</em>树的基本用法,我自己打了代码,其实就是照模板来的,大概思想已经弄懂了。用c++不能过,说我超时,就改成c的读入读出,这坑爹的过了。我最爱

    https://www.u72.net/daima/uexf.html - 2024-07-14 15:52:08 - 代码库
  • 15:poj1556The Doors

    链接枚举两点 若不和任何<em>线段</em>相交 建边为dis(i,j) floyd求最短路  1 #include &lt;iostream&gt;  2 #include&lt

    https://www.u72.net/daima/vu4u.html - 2024-07-15 04:01:06 - 代码库
  • 16:POJ 1195 Mobile phones (二维树状数组)

    思路分析:这题discuss 上说二维<em>线段</em>树过不了。所以二维树状数组搞。理解树状数组的

    https://www.u72.net/daima/vsev.html - 2024-07-15 03:19:41 - 代码库
  • 17:UVa 10020 (最小区间覆盖) Minimal coverage

    题意:数轴上有n个闭区间[ai, bi],选择尽量少的区间覆盖一条指定<em>线段</em>[0, m]算法:[start, end]为已经覆盖到的区间这是一道贪心把各个区间先按照左端点从小

    https://www.u72.net/daima/27mk.html - 2024-07-20 14:53:10 - 代码库
  • 18:算法及定理证明

    RSA算法原理黑客教程网址大全扩展欧几里德算法卡特兰数莫比乌斯反演反素数深度分析可持久化<em>线段</em>树STL Rope位运算及位优化最近公共祖先LCA转RMQ十个利

    https://www.u72.net/daima/20m4.html - 2024-07-20 08:30:15 - 代码库
  • 19:codeforces 430A Points and Segments (easy)(理解能力有待提高……)

    题目    //终于看懂题目了,,,,//一条<em>线段</em>里面不是每个坐标上都有要染色的点,所以为了满足条件,只能考虑那些给出坐标的点//所以就要排序一下了,不能直接根据坐

    https://www.u72.net/daima/3n7b.html - 2024-07-20 20:33:59 - 代码库
  • 20:poj3264 Balanced Lineup

    思路:<em>线段</em>树。实现: 1 #include &lt;iostream&gt; 2 #in

    https://www.u72.net/daima/3bvx.html - 2024-09-02 17:22:12 - 代码库